Kenneth Wenning
Kenneth J. Wenning, 71, McCartyville, died at 2:15 p.m. Sept. 24, 2013, at Heritage Manor Nursing Center, Minster.
He was born Aug. 21, 1942, in Chickasaw, to Joseph and Josephine Depweg Moeller Wenning. On Sept. 14, 1963, he married Marceil L. "Marcy" Schmackers in St. Henry, and she preceded him in death Oct. 14, 2002. He then married Barbara Feltz Boeckman on Aug. 5, 2006, and she survives in McCartyville.
He is also survived by children, Joseph (Terri) Wenning, Kalida, Jeffery (Tamara) Wenning, Arcanum, Scott Wenning, North Carolina, Patrick (Leigh Anne) Wenning, Sidney, Sheri (Kevin) Pohlman, Maria Stein, Timothy Boeckman, Osgood, Stacy (Brent) Bruggeman, McCartyville, Toby Boeckman, St. Marys, and Stephanie Boeckman, St. Marys; a daughter-in-law, Theresa Boeckman, Coldwater; 18 grandchildren; four great-grandchildren; brothers and sisters, Mark (Joan) Wenning, St. Henry, Bernice Barge, Montezuma, and Madonna (Joseph) Rose, Coldwater; and sisters-in-law, Alberta Wenning, Coldwater, and Betty Wenning, Coldwater.
He was preceded in death by a son, Ty Boeckman; brothers and sisters, Julietta (Ralph) Muhlenkamp, Isadore Wenning, Norbert Wenning, Rita (Dick) Wenning, Hilda (Carl) Axe, Fred (Alma) Moeller, Martha (H.F.) Rawley, Rose Mary (Cornelius) Muhlenkamp, Louis (Mary) Moeller, Virginia (Harry) Streacker; a sister-in-law, Velma Wenning; and a brother-in-law, Ralph Barge.
He was a member of Sacred Heart of Jesus Catholic Church, McCartyville, where he was on the Mission Commission and a volunteer. He was a veteran of the U.S. Air Force and a member of the American Legion, Minster; F.O.E. #1391 Minster; and the McCartyville Knights of Columbus. He retired from Crown Equipment, New Bremen.
Mass of Christian Burial will be 10:30 a.m. Friday at Sacred Heart of Jesus Catholic Church, McCartyville, the Rev. John Tonkin celebrant.
Friends may call 2-8 p.m. Thursday and 9-10 a.m. Friday at Sacred Heart of Jesus Catholic Church, McCartyville. Burial will take place in Sacred Heart Cemetery.
Memorials may be given to the Holy Family Church, Booneville, Ky.
Funeral arrangements were handled by Hogenkamp Funeral Home, Minster.
